Westinghouse announces a new small nuclear reactor — a notable step in the industry’s efforts to remake itself

Westinghouse announced the launch of a small version of its flagship AP1000 nuclear reactor on Thursday. The new reactor, called the AP300, aims to be available in 2027, and will generate about a third of the power as the flagship AP1000 reactor, enough to power about 300,000 homes. Hot Functional Testing completed for Vogtle Unit 4

Georgia Power today announced the completion of hot functional testing for Unit 4 at the Vogtle nuclear expansion project near Waynesboro, Ga. The completion of hot functional testing marks a significant step towards operations and providing customers with a reliable, carbon-free energy source for the next 60 to 80 years. Mass deployment of Holtec SMRs in Ukraine is part of accord’s aims

Energoatom President Petro Kotin at the signing ceremony (Image: Energoatom) Up to 20 Holtec SMR-160 plants will be built in Ukraine under a cooperation agreement signed between Holtec International and Ukrainian national nuclear operator Energoatom.
